keyboard keymap is messed up. the down button brings up a window pointing to my home


I have a Dell Latitude C600 and whenever I hit the down button on my keyboard rather than scrolling down a web page or a document a window comes up showing my home folder. When I log in as root the down buttom it works just fine. How can i fix it so that the down button does what it is suppose to?
